Telegraphic Speech
A stage in language development where toddlers combine a limited number of words to convey a message, mimicking the concise style of telegraphic messages.
Babbling
A stage in language development involving the production of sounds, combinations of sounds, and syllables that precede the formation of meaningful words.
Critical Period
A specific time during development when the presence or absence of certain experiences has a long-lasting impact on the individual.
Language Acquisition
Language Acquisition is the process by which humans gain the ability to perceive, produce, and use words to communicate effectively.
